From Love to Jealousy: Joseph's Colorful Coat


 



In the land of Canaan, young Joseph stood so tall, A coat of many colors, a gift loved by all. His father Jacob smiled, his pride a radiant light, But envy grew among his kin, in the fading night. Oh, Joseph’s dreams, visions of the stars, Promises of greatness, reaching near and far. But brothers full of anger, could not see the way, In a world of shadows, their hearts began to stray.
